4767. RB to George Mignaty
As published in The Brownings’ Correspondence, 28, 203.
[Florence]
Wednesday. [24 October 1860] [1]
Dear Mr Mignaty,
Madame Du Quaire is here for a few days on her way to Rome—her husband died six weeks ago: [2] she does not go out, but would be very glad to see you any time after 4. oclock at the Hôtel de la Ville.
Yours very sincerely
Robert Browning.
Publication: None traced.
Manuscript: Biblioteca Nazionale di Centrale Firenze.
1. Dated by RB’s reference to the death of Mme. du Quaire’s husband (see note 2 below).
2. Gaston Felix Henri du Quaire (1833–60) died on 13 September at Hyères.
